drm/nouveau: wait for the exclusive fence after the shared ones v2
commit 67f74302f45d5d862f22ced3297624e50ac352f0 upstream. Always waiting for the exclusive fence resulted on some performance regressions. So try to wait for the shared fences first, then the exclusive fence should always be signaled already. v2: fix incorrectly placed "(", add some comment why we do this.
